Mr. Gino-o: Elevating Filipino Craftsmanship

At the heart of the evening was the Mr. Gino-o brand, a trailblazer in reimagining traditional Filipino garments for the modern era. Known for its innovative reinterpretation of the Barong Tagalog, the brand has successfully maintained the garment’s cultural essence while infusing it with a trendy, contemporary appeal.

Founded by Albert Prias, Mr. Gino-o: Made for Men is dedicated to promoting Philippine products and materials such as abaca, jusi, piña, banana fibre, inaul, inabel, and tinalak hand-woven fabrics. Each collection showcases the exquisite beauty of these materials, tailored to captivate the global market and elevate Filipino craftsmanship to international prominence.

Rene Rivas: A Multicultural Icon and Fashion Maestro

The event will also feature the iconic works of Rene Rivas, a multi-awarded fashion designer and artist extraordinaire. With a career spanning over three decades, Rivas is a celebrated figure in film, theatre, opera, television, and magazines. His most notable contributions include the costume designs for the 2000 Sydney Olympics and various international pageants, exhibitions, and the Sydney Gay and Lesbian Mardi Gras.

Rene Rivas is recognised not only for his artistic achievements but also for his commitment to the LGBTQIA+ community and multiculturalism in Australia. In 1986, he founded the Latin American LGBTQA community and friends group to promote multiculturalism, diversity, human rights, inclusion, and social equality. He continues to be a dedicated advocate for transgender youth and survivors of discrimination, abuse, and religious persecution.

His extensive contributions have earned him numerous accolades, such as the SGLMG Lifetime Achievement Award (2016) and the Ron Amuncaster Costume Award (2002). His costumes, now showcased at the Powerhouse Museum’s “Absolutely Queer” exhibition, will also be exhibited at the National Gallery of Australia, Museum of Contemporary Art, and other prominent galleries across Australia, solidifying his legacy as a leading multicultural designer.
